Output 27077b3e8f312fc9d8a8c9228e948dc62e096e94bbd6e250fe23493e4b7d6184:65

value
134862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57708b1d3ee227e65c6c49a912bc5658bec4973a OP_EQUAL
address
39fMXtNedfg1Qjy8zHEPqJoChHv86Mtmyg
transaction
27077b3e8f312fc9d8a8c9228e948dc62e096e94bbd6e250fe23493e4b7d6184
spent
true